Froot by the Foot, often simply called Froot, is a captivating hybrid strain developed by the renowned breeders at Atlas Seed. This innovative cultivar was created through a deliberate pursuit to harmonize the best characteristics of ruderalis, indica, and sativa genetics, resulting in a versatile and robust plant that appeals to both novice enthusiasts and seasoned connoisseurs. Atlas Seed introduced Froot with a focus on delivering a distinctive experience, and it quickly garnered attention for its appealing genetic makeup that promises both notable potency and an exceptionally enjoyable sensory profile. The strain's name hints at its complex, fruity terpene expression, making it a standout choice for those seeking a well-rounded hybrid. As a testament to its quality, Froot has become a favorite among collectors, celebrated for its balanced effects and intricate flavor journey that truly lives up to its enticing moniker.
The visual presentation of the Froot strain is as appealing as its name suggests. The buds are typically dense and chunky, showcasing a classic hybrid structure that balances indica bulk with sativa elongation. A vibrant coat of trichomes gives the flowers a frosty, crystalline appearance, signaling its potent genetic lineage. The color palette is a feast for the eyes, featuring deep forest green nugs often streaked with hues of purple and amber, all accented by fiery orange pistils. For cultivators, Froot is known to be a moderately challenging yet rewarding plant. It thrives in controlled environments where temperature and humidity can be carefully managed. The flowering period typically spans 8 to 10 weeks, and when grown with care, it offers a generous yield of resinous, aromatic buds that fully express its complex genetic potential.

The effects of the Froot strain are where its hybrid nature shines most brilliantly, offering a beautifully balanced experience that engages both mind and body. The onset is typically cerebral and uplifting, inducing a wave of euphoria and mental clarity that sparks creativity and promotes a happy, optimistic mindset. This initial cerebral buzz is smooth and not overwhelming, making it suitable for social situations or creative pursuits. As the experience progresses, a deeply relaxing physical sensation gently spreads throughout the body, melting away tension and stress without causing heavy sedation. Users often report feeling calm, content, and pleasantly anchored, making Froot an excellent choice for unwinding after a long day while remaining mentally present. This harmonious balance prevents the couch-lock associated with heavy indicas while offering more substantial relaxation than pure sativas, embodying the ideal hybrid experience.

To fully appreciate the nuanced profile of Froot, certain consumption methods and timing are recommended. For flavor connoisseurs, vaporizing at low to medium temperatures (around 350°F) beautifully preserves the delicate terpenes, offering the cleanest taste of its sweet, citrus, and earthy notes. Traditional smoking in a clean glass piece also provides a robust and immediate experience of its effects. Given its balanced hybrid nature, Froot is exceptionally versatile regarding timing. Its initial cerebral lift makes it suitable for afternoon use when you need a mood boost alongside relaxation. However, its calming physical properties also make it an excellent choice for evening consumption to unwind and de-stress before settling in for the night, offering flexibility depending on your desired outcome.
